Description

Quit rents: forwards despatch from the administrator, Augustus Frederick Gore, on the subject of reviving claims for payment. [See also CO 321/3/2, 6 and 14]. Colonial Office consents to the abandonment of the proposal to revive the quit rent.

Rawson William Rawson, Governor of Windward Islands, St Vincent No. 72. Folios 255-261.
